      The name Cassondra has its origins in the Greek language and carries the meaning To Excel Over Men. This name is derived from the combination of the Greek words kassandra, which means to excel, and aner, which translates to man. In the realm of history, the name Cassondra traces its roots back to ancient Greek mythology as Cassandra, a prophetess and daughter of King Priam and Queen Hecuba of Troy. Known for her unparalleled beauty and divine visions, Cassandra was cursed by the god Apollo, causing her prophecies to be disbelieved by those around her.

      In modern-day usage, the name Cassondra has retained its powerful connotation. Often seen as a variant spelling of Cassandra, it continues to evoke the idea of excelling and surpassing men.
